Information on maximal oxygen uptake
According to tortora (2000)"Maximal oxygen uptake can be defined as the maximal amount of oxygen that can be taken in, transported and consumed by the working muscles during maximal exercise. Those who are more fit have higher VO2 max values and can exercise more intensely than those who are not as well conditioned". (p211) When exercise commences the uptake of oxygen rises rapidly during the first few minutes of exercise. If you are doing steady-rate
